Accidental Brothers tells the story of two sets of swapped twins. This Netflix documentary tells the true story of these young Colombians who were mistakenly swapped at birth and reveals how they met again 25 years later.
The script of the play was written by Alessandro Angulo and Diego Chaleira. It should be noted that the first was also in charge of the direction.
This Colombian-made feature film explores the lives of Jorge and Carlos Bernal and William and Wilbur Cañas, who grew up in different environments without knowing that their true biological families were different.


How did the documentary arrive?
In 2014, the Colombian show “Séptimo día” announced the exchange of twins, which was then discussed in different programs around the world until the creation of “Accidental Brothers”.
According to the synopsis provided by the media Prensa Libre and Rating Cero, the existence of the exchange was revealed almost by accident after a woman named Laura Vega visited a butcher shop in Bogota with her friend Yaneth. There, Laura saw that the butcher William Canas (one of the transformed twins and cousin of Yaneth’s husband) and her friend Jorge Enrique Bernal Castro were the same person. In fact, at first he thought it was him.
Laura and Yannis continue their investigation until they discover that the two young people have an identical twin and become aware of the communication between the two families. They talk to Jorge and from that point on, the true story begins to come to light.
Jorge, a mechanical engineering student, decided to look for William Cañas Velasco on Facebook. But he was even more surprised when he saw a picture of William and his brother Wilbur, who looked exactly like Jorge’s twin, Carlos.
After some time, the four of them meet and the twins feel emotionally shaken considering how it feels to face this event 25 years later. The story continues to the present day and what has happened between them, their similarities and differences, families and education.

The case took place at the Bogota Maternity and Child Hospital, where Carlos and Jorge were born on December 21, 1988, the day after Wilbur and William were born.
In addition to the twins, Accidental Brothers also stars Juan Guillermo Mercado, Manuel Teodoro, Don Francisco (Mario Luis Kreuzberg), Chiquibaby (Stephanie Simonides), Brooke Baldwin, Laura Vega, Yanet Paez and Dr. Nancy Siegel, who gives her own take on the case: “This is the kind of experiment that scientists dream of, but they could never do ethically.”
According to the Colombian portal Cambio, the production team of this documentary faced many challenges. On the one hand, there was the investigation and organization of archival materials involving many people.
“As always, the greatest difficulty was acquiring the document. Often people throw away or lose photos and videos, which makes archaeological work difficult. On the other hand, telling four stories is always a challenge, even more so in this case involving a living relationship that continues to this day. The premise of the exchange of twins, the chance meeting again, was a great trigger for the story. It was fascinating to get to know them, to get to know each and every one of their worlds,” Alessandro Angulo said in an interview with the aforementioned website.
